Looks a nice recipe but I would add my eggs one at a time to stop curdling
As long as all the ingredients are at room temperature, then you should not experience curdling. When using a stand mixer, adding the eggs one at a time can help them to combine better, but with a hand held mixer you can add them all at once. I hope you try the cake!
